Q

how should the camera be set up when analysing data?

A
  • perpendicular to the plane of motion (CS=coronal)
  • have whole body in the shot
  • set zoom, focus, shutter speed and lighting
  • contrasting background
  • uncluttered

Q

why might someones posture be different with knee pain?

A
  • pain itself can cause people to move differently
  • weakness in activation of muscles shown by EMG data
  • imbalance in quads (medial and lateral)
  • weakness around the glutes causing trendelenberg- changes Q angle of the femur
  • results in the patella tracking laterally instead of up and down
  • glides laterally and grinds on femoral surface causing pain and inflammation PATELLA FEMORAL SYDROME
